Long-term alcoholism and certain infections can lead to liver disease such as cirrhosis. During this disease, so-called scars form in the organ. They cause stagnation of blood in the veins of the esophagus. Over time, the walls of the veins expand and gradually stretch. When they cannot withstand the gradually increasing pressure, the veins can burst, causing sudden profuse bleeding from the mouth.

If the blood flowing from the mouth flows gradually in the form of a uniform trickle without foam and has a cherry color, then this may indicate bleeding from the veins in the esophagus. It is considered one of the most dangerous species hemorrhages and most often appears in people suffering from chronic liver disease. While waiting for an ambulance, it is necessary to put the person in bed so that top part the torso was somewhat elevated. The patient is prohibited from making sudden movements or getting up.
If blood goes through the mouth from the lungs, then such a hemorrhage is accompanied by a cough. In this case, the blood has a bright red color, it foams and does not coagulate. Even if there is very little of it, then in no case should you refuse to call an ambulance. The person should be placed in a chair or bed and given cold water to drink in small portions. Cold water or ice cubes can help stop the bleeding. You also need to ask the person to control the cough and, if possible, contain it.

When bloody inclusions appear after waking up, you need to examine the oral cavity. The symptom is typical for inflammatory processes in the gums.
Bleeding with periodontitis and gingivitis is usually accompanied by redness and swelling of the mucous membrane. On initial stage diseases, until the changes began in the deep layers, blood in the mouth appears after sleeping and brushing teeth. If this moment is missed, inflammation affects the periodontal ligaments, leading to a defect in the dentition.
Bleeding can provoke tartar, which is traumatic soft tissue.
Deficiency of vitamins K and B, ascorbic acid, tocopherol negatively affects the condition of the gums. The nutrition of the tissues deteriorates, the production of collagen decreases, and the structure of the gums is disrupted. During the day, a person drinks water, has a snack, so the taste of blood in the mouth is not felt. After sleep, it is more pronounced.
Blood inclusions in saliva during pregnancy may indicate a lack of calcium. The mineral is spent on the formation of the fetal bone skeleton.
Blood in the mouth in the morning is often observed during menopause, the causes of bleeding gums - a decrease in estrogen production and hormonal changes.
Bleeding occurs with vascular neoplasms in the oral mucosa (pyogenic granuloma). Nodule formation is localized mainly on the gums, does not cause pain, is easily injured and bleeds.
Bloody discharge in the morning may appear after a night cough. Often, laryngeal polyps do not make themselves felt and come off with a strong cough.
Small nose bleed goes unnoticed at night. In a horizontal position, blood from the nose enters the pharynx and mixes with the secretion of the salivary glands. In the morning, a metallic taste and mucous discharge with blood worries.
Symptoms of inflammation of the tonsils, nasopharynx intensify after sleep. Pink saliva appears with excessive dryness of the pharynx, irritation with a strong cough.
Blood clots in the mouth in the morning are observed with malignant tumors of the larynx or pharynx. The vessels of healthy tissues are destroyed by germinating cancer cells.

The pronounced taste of metal is felt after biting the cheek during sleep. The damage is self-detected after visual inspection.
Bloody inclusions in saliva in the morning appear with erosive inflammation of the gastric mucosa. The symptom is combined with other pathological manifestations: heartburn, nausea, pain in the upper abdomen.
Taste of blood in asthmatics in morning time due to drying out of the oral mucosa due to breathing problems. Dehydration disrupts taste buds.
Pink saliva on the pillow is found in tuberculosis, even in the absence of cough. The disease is characterized by increased sweating at night, a slight increase in temperature in the evening, poor appetite, coughing.
During a night cough, while taking Heparin, Marevan, reddish streaks often appear in saliva, which disappear after a few days.
With many heart diseases, blood circulation deteriorates, the lungs suffer from congestion. There is a cough with blood-stained saliva, shortness of breath.
A metallic taste without the appearance of blood clots can provoke pathologies nervous system including Alzheimer's disease. Disruption of communication between the brain and taste buds causes taste changes.
The composition of saliva is changed by some medicines, vitamin complexes with high content gland. After the end of therapy, the taste of metal disappears.

The taste of blood in the mouth in the morning is metallic, slightly salty. In addition to the characteristic taste, other symptoms are observed: pain or discomfort in the mouth, an unpleasant sour or putrid odor, sores or wounds on the inside of the cheeks and lips, tongue or tonsils, fever, white, yellowish or brownish plaque, increased salivation.
Interesting fact: the presence of blood is not necessarily manifested in the presence of a bright scarlet liquid. When mixed with saliva, the hue changes to pinkish. The clotting process darkens the blood: in a caked state, it becomes dark burgundy or brown. If additional impurities (pus, food debris) are present, the color becomes even more unusual.

The taste of blood is sometimes observed with reflux, when a small amount of acidic stomach contents enter the esophagus. This happens in the morning - in a horizontal position, it is easier for gastric juice to rise into the oral cavity.
Dental diseases are the main cause of reddish discharge in the mouth. Why is there blood flowing from the mouth? Stomatitis, gingivitis, periodontitis cause inflammation of the gums or teeth. The mucous membrane becomes very sensitive, and an increase in red discharge occurs after using a dental floss or brush. The gums are damaged by the bristles and cause discomfort. Tuberculosis can be asymptomatic for a long time. With clinical manifestations, a person has pallor, weakness, low temperature, sweating and weight loss. In the course of the active development of the disease, sputum discharge occurs, tuberculous pleurisy and hemoptysis when coughing join. A transparent saliva with streaks of a reddish-rusty color is released. The disease is common, transmitted by airborne droplets.

An unpleasant phenomenon as a result of the extirpation procedure is caused, in most cases, by two reasons:
Previously, dentists recommended rinsing the patient after the intervention. However, modern doctors do not advise doing such procedures. This is due to the fact that as a result of manipulations, the blood plug is torn off and hemorrhage appears.
If your dentist has told you not to rinse your mouth, then it makes sense to listen to a qualified professional.

With gum disease, bleeding is eliminated by rinsing your mouth with an antiseptic solution. Solutions of Chlorhexidine, Miramistin, decoctions of Chamomile, Calendula will remove unpleasant sensations, strengthen the gums and have a tonic effect on them. Despite the fact that you can eliminate unpleasant symptoms on your own, it will not work to cure gum disease without the help of a doctor. In order to eliminate the pathology, it is necessary to carry out high-quality treatment by a periodontist. The complex of therapeutic measures includes: removal of hard deposits, teeth polishing, antiseptic treatment of gum pockets. After treatment with a dentist, it is recommended to carefully follow the doctor's prescriptions. The treatment course includes: antiseptic rinsing, gum treatment with anti-inflammatory gels and ointments, applications.
With advanced forms of periodontal disease, they resort to surgical methods of treatment. Timely treatment of gingivitis and the observance of strict hygiene rules in the future guarantees patients the absence of the development of periodontitis and complications.

The causes of bleeding can be determined by the color of the physiological fluid, accompanying symptoms, and the duration of bleeding. With perforation of a stomach ulcer and acute gastritis, causing erosion of the mucous membrane, the blood can be bright, and its separation is abundant. The condition is especially dangerous for young strong men.
When dark-colored blood comes out of the mouth, the veins in the esophagus are most often damaged. Injuries of an external or internal nature can lead to this condition. Vessels can be damaged by swallowing a solid piece of food, a foreign object (such as a bone or shard of glass), or by hitting the throat. There is a high risk of vomiting with blood with chemical damage to the mucous membranes of the digestive tract or after drug / alcohol intoxication.
Brown vomit appears with exacerbation of colitis, with cirrhosis of the liver, bleeding ulcers of the stomach or duodenum. In this case, the clots come out along with the half-digested food. At the same time, abdominal pain and dyspepsia occur.
Bleeding from the mouth can occur with stomatitis, if the erosion formed on the mucous membrane is damaged. In order not to violate the integrity of fibrin, which tightens the wounds, during the disease, you should switch to liquid soft food. Dishes should not be heated above + 35 ... + 37 ° С.
